792 m² consolidated urban plot in Trobajo del Camino, with 945 m² residential buildability. Suitable for residential development in a consolidated metropolitan area.

This is a shortlisting pass over the advert's data, not a due diligence report. Before deciding, check the points we cannot verify from here:

  • Planning classification and real buildable area: confirm both with the town hall before anything else.
  • Available services and connections (water, electricity, drainage, vehicle access).
  • The real service charge and, above all, whether any special levies are approved or pending: they appear in the minutes of the last owners' meetings.
  • The property's actual IBI: our figure is an estimate from the municipality's cadastral values, not the specific bill.
  • Charges, mortgages, seizures or easements in the Land Registry extract.
